Having just moved into the Fifth Doctor/Turlogh stories, I got to thinking about these Fifth Doctor/one companion eras that Big Finish has been able to exploit (and "Fifth Doctor alone" eras they've been able to create). It feels unusual and a very creative twist for a Doctor who always had a group of companions until his very last story. And then it occurred to me that since Tegan was waiting in the TARDIS all through Excelis Rising, Big Finish now has an opening for some Fifth Doctor/Tegan stories!
Since Janet Fielding started working with Big Finish, they focused on doing the Tegan/Turlough/Older Nyssa stories for five years; we're now getting some Nyssa/Tegan stories starting in January; and hopefully we'll get some Tegan/Turlough stories in 2017. I'd really like it if after that we got a trilogy (or an anthology disc) with just the Fifth Doctor and Tegan, just to see how their dynamic works when there's no one else involved. (I'm not sure if The Gathering is a fair example since he's visiting her after she left the TARDIS, so their relationship is at a very different point than it would have been during the series.)

I don't think Five and Tegan ever did travel alone though. Turlough joined before Nyssa left, and Tegan left before Turlough left. For Tegan to be Five's only companion, Nyssa or Turlough would have to go on vacation or something stupid like that.

In the final episode of Frontios the Doctor and Tegan go off in the TARDIS to deposit the Gravis on a barren planet. I think there are a couple of Short Trips in this gap, and the Fifth Doctor Excelis story takes place here too, Tegan absent because she's sulking in the TARDIS. The Gathering is set during Peri and Erimem for the Doctor (Perimem are in Monte Carlo for The Veiled Leopard) and for Tegan it's set after her departure in Resurrection of the Daleks, having taken the long way to 2006.
